#134c8c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#134c8c is composed of 7.5% red, 29.8%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 211.7 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 31.2%. #134c8c color hex could be obtained by blending #2698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#134c8c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#134c8c has RGB values of R:19, G:76,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 1264780.

Hex triplet 134c8c #134c8c
RGB Decimal 19, 76, 140 rgb(19,76,140)
RGB Percent 7.5, 29.8, 54.9 rgb(7.5%,29.8%,54.9%)
CMYK 86, 46, 0, 45
HSL 211.7°, 76.1, 31.2 hsl(211.7,76.1%,31.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 211.7°, 86.4, 54.9
Web Safe 003399 #003399
CIE-LAB 32.258, 7.262, -40.556
XYZ 7.586, 7.2, 25.799
xyY 0.187, 0.177, 7.2
CIE-LCH 32.258, 41.201, 280.151
CIE-LUV 32.258, -17.032, -55.588
Hunter-Lab 26.833, 3.503, -38.223
Binary 00010011, 01001100, 10001100

Shades and Tints of #134c8c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f0f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#134c8c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4f55 is the less saturated color, while #014b9e is the most saturated one.
